Exploring Isaiah 55:8: Understanding Divine Wisdom

Understanding the Context of Isaiah 55:8

Isaiah 55:8 presents a profound reflection on the nature of God’s thoughts and ways compared to human understanding. This verse states, “For my thoughts are not your thoughts, neither are your ways my ways, declares the Lord.” Such a declaration invites believers to recognize the vast chasm that exists between divine wisdom and human reasoning.

The Significance of Divine Perspective

In this verse, Isaiah underscores the infinite wisdom of God. Unlike human beings who often rely on limited, immediate interpretations of their lives, His wisdom encompasses the grand narrative of existence. This disparity highlights the importance of trusting in God’s plans, especially when circumstances seem incomprehensible or challenging.

Applying Isaiah 55:8 to Daily Life

Understanding Isaiah 55:8 encourages individuals to reflect on their personal experiences. When faced with uncertainty, this verse can serve as a reminder that God operates on a plane beyond our comprehension. Embracing this belief can lead to a profound sense of peace and reassurance, knowing that a higher wisdom is at work, even when we struggle to see the bigger picture.
